Antique Victorian Mediterranean Coral Grape Brooch
About the Item
Discover this exquisite antique grape brooch from the Victorian Romantic era, featuring a natural Mediterranean coral. This brooch is a testament to the high skill of English jewelers during the Victorian period, and its timeless design is not affected by the passage of time, fashion, styles, or materials. The brooch was crafted in the second half of the 19th century, and features hand-engraved yellow polished and brushed gold that creates a fantastic contrast. It is set in 9K gold and secured by a C clasp.
Please note that there are traces of repairs on the reverse side of the brooch, which is to be expected given its age.
During Victorian times, coral was believed to promote good health and bring a long life. This gorgeous antique coral brooch is of a nice size, measuring approximately 1.5" (40mm) x 1.4" (35mm), and weighs 8 grams.
